Your private boat tour begins in Ċirkewwa, where you will meet your skipper before setting off on a scenic boat trip to Comino, Blue Lagoon, Crystal Lagoon, and hidden sea caves.
As we sail toward Comino Island, we pass Lantern Rock, a spot known for its colorful reef and marine life. We then explore Lovers’ Cave and cruise past Pigeon Rock Islet before stopping at Crystal Lagoon, a secluded swimming and snorkeling paradise with turquoise waters and underwater caves.
Next, we visit the Comino Caves, known for their stunning reflections and hidden chambers, before heading to Cominotto Islet. Our final stop is Blue Lagoon, where we anchor in the clearest waters, away from the crowds, for another relaxing swim or snorkel.

Crystal Lagoon is one of Malta’s best-kept secrets, located just beside the Blue Lagoon on Comino Island. With its deep turquoise waters, dramatic limestone cliffs, and hidden sea caves, it offers a more secluded and peaceful experience compared to its famous neighbor. What makes Crystal Lagoon truly special is its calm, deep waters, perfect for swimming, snorkeling, and even cliff diving. The lagoon is surrounded by natural caves, including some only accessible by boat, making it an incredible spot for exploration. A private boat trip is the best way to experience Crystal Lagoon. Comino, a small island between Malta and Gozo, is famous for its pristine waters, hidden caves, and breathtaking lagoons. Despite its size, it’s one of Malta’s most stunning destinations, offering crystal-clear swimming spots and rugged coastal landscapes. With a private boat trip, you can explore Comino’s best locations, including the famous Blue Lagoon, the more secluded Crystal Lagoon, and the fascinating Comino Caves. These hidden caves are only accessible by boat, making them perfect for snorkeling, swimming, and exploring Malta’s underwater world.
